Chelsea, Vt vs Malakal Climate & Distance Between

Sudan flag
  • The distance between Chelsea, Vt, Usa and Malakal, Sudan is approximately 10,375 km or 6,447 mi.
  • To reach Chelsea, Vt in this distance one would set out from Malakal bearing 315.7°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Chelsea, Vt bearing 253.3° or WSW .
  • Chelsea, Vt has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Malakal has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
  • Chelsea, Vt is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Malakal is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 23.2 °C (41.8°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 24.1 °C (43.4°F) more in Chelsea, Vt.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 199.2 mm (7.8 in) more which is equivalent to 199.2 l/m² (4.89 US gal/ft²) or 1,992,000 l/ha (212,958 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/4 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 27.7° lower in Chelsea, Vt than in Malakal.
